Interested or Preparing for a Career in Law Enforcement
Class experience
US Grade 9 - 12
Beginner Level
Over the last eight years, I have taught Criminal Justice classes to students from ages 13-18. This class will help educate older students that are considering the field of Law Enforcement. We will cover the process of getting hired, the police academy, the ranks within a department, job opportunities, words of wisdom, and much more. I will also tell you about a couple of calls I responded to during my twenty-six year law enforcement career, such as: Accidents, SWAT Team responses, funny...
